Transaction 32b03d3b61a0eef14f0a5ad8825504a502c858da85d96923b4aa143235d63725

1 Input
2 Outputs
  • 32b03d3b61a0eef14f0a5ad8825504a502c858da85d96923b4aa143235d63725:0
  • value  7988610
    address  2MuDN6wpuow9aaNRaWWApcskf7jT3LQMJ7X
  • 32b03d3b61a0eef14f0a5ad8825504a502c858da85d96923b4aa143235d63725:1
  • value  6870454313
    address  2N1ygED5i3SML9HkPepL17SNC26v8BD4XXH